2022 World Juniors Championship cancelled due to COVID-19, Omicron

IIHF World Juniors Championship 2022 remaining Schedule is Cancelled due to Rapid increase in COVID-19 & Omicron cases..






Following a recommendation by the tournament COVID-19 Medical Group and the IIHF Medical Committee, the IIHF Council has decided that, due to the ongoing spread of COVID-19 and the Omicron variant, the 2022 IIHF World Junior Championship will be cancelled to ensure the health and safety of all participants.

The decision comes following a positive case on a player on the Russian national team, which would have necessitated a forfeit of the Russia-Slovakia game scheduled for 29 December. The game is the third to be cancelled due to positive cases, following Switzerland-USA and Finland-Czechia.



In addition to ensuring the health and safety of participants, the Council has determined that with another forfeiture – the third forfeited game in two days – the sportive integrity of the event has been compromised, and the event must be cancelled. IIHF Official Statement on World Juniors 2022 Cancelation.



“Together with the teams, we came into this event with full confidence in the COVID-19 protocols put in place by the IIHF, the LOC, Alberta Health, Alberta Health Services and the Public Health Agency of Canada,” said IIHF President Luc Tardif. “The ongoing spread of COVID-19 and the Omicron variant forced us to readjust our protocols almost immediately upon arrival to attempt to stay ahead of any potential spread. This included daily testing and the team quarantine requirement when positive cases were confirmed.”

“We owed it to the participating teams to do our best to create the conditions necessary for this event to work,” said Tardif. “Unfortunately, this was not enough. We now have to take some time and focus on getting all players and team staff back home safely.”

 The 2022 World Junior Ice Hockey Championships (2022 WJHC) will be the 46th edition of the Ice Hockey World Junior Championship. It will starts on December 26, 2021, and WJC Final will end with the gold medal game being played on January 5, 2022.


 It will be the 15th World Juniors to be played in Canada and will take place at the newly built Rogers Place, home to the NHL's Edmonton Oilers and Oil Kings of the Western Hockey League (WHL) and the ENMAX Centrium, home to the WHL's Red Deer rebels.
